Below is a statement from the Wiltshire Speed Camera Partnership (issued 18/02/05) which indicates that they will not be pursuing prosecutions against drivers caught speeding on the A303 at Folly Bottom during 2003/2004. This has several repurcussions :-

Any drivers who have already been prosecuted for speeding during the specific dates can have those convictions quashed, the points taken off their licences, their fines repaid and make a claim for compensation for any losses they have suffered as a result of the wrongful conviction (eg increased insurance premium).

Other drivers who have been caught in the area and who cannot recall having seen clear speed restriction signs are now having their cases reviewed. These matters have been adjourned until 30 June 2005, but the CPS are expected to make a decision and statement about these cases before this date.
